Equity issues refer to concerns about fairness and justice in various contexts. They often arise in discussions about wealth distribution and social equality. In India, equity issues are significant in law and economic policies. They influence access to resources and opportunities. Addressing these issues is crucial for societal harmony. Effective solutions promote inclusivity and support disadvantaged communities.
